" ~ ~~ILLS MEMORANDUM DATE: TO: October 20, 2005 Agenda Item 6.A. Honorable Mayor and City Council Members FROM: Michelle A. Wolfe, City Administrator Schawn P. Johnson, Assistant to the City AdministratorSlt-> Murtuza Siddiqui, Finance Director SUBJECT: Appointmcnt of Michelle Bruley as the City's AccOlUlting Analyst BACKGROUND In September, City staff began recruitment efforts for hiring an Accounting Analyst. The City received nine applications for the open Accounting Analyst position in September. Five candidates were asked to participate in the first round interviews, The first round of interviews was conducted by Murtuza Siddiqui and Schawn Johnson on October 14th. Based upon the first round of interviews, the top two candidates were invited back to participate in the second round of interviews, Those intervicws were condllctcd on October 19th. Michellc Wolfe, Murtuza Siddiqui, and Schawn Johnson were part of the interview panel for thc second round of interviews. DISCUSSION Based upon the interview process and work related experiencc, the recommended candidate is Ms, Michelle Bruley, In 2004, Ms, Bruley received a Bachelor of Science Degree in Accounting from Metropolitan State University, In March 2005, Ms. Bruley was hired by Comtal Machine and Engineering as a staff accountant In September, her job as a Staff Accountant was eliminated when Com tal Machine and Engineering of White Bear Lakc announced that the company was going out of business. In her role as Staff Accountant for Comtal Machine and Engineering, she was responsible for accounts receivables, accounts payable, customer invoices, general ledgers, and producing end-of,the-month financial reports, Ms, Bruley was also employed by Metro One Telecommunication Company of Roseville for four years as a floor supervisor. She was responsible for supervising twenty-five employees that handled customer service related phone calls, She was also responsible for monitoring staffing levels and employee performances. She has also workcd as a bank teller for Heartland Credit Union in Arden Hills. f , . . Page 2 of2 Ms, Michelle Bruley has a solid background in general accounting and has indicated a strong interest in this position with the City of Arden Hills. Reference checks have been completed and the responses from her previous employers have been very good, RECOMMENDATION City staff is requesting City Council approval of the appointment of Ms, Michelle Bruley as an Accounting Analyst for the City of Arden Hills, \\Metro-inctus\ArdenIli11s\Admin\Human Resources\CLASSlfICA TIONS\AccQunting Analyst\2005 Recruitment\Candidate Letters\City Council Memos\Memo to CC-Michelle Burley.doc
